Transaction e16f59108b9b0a575997cdb075732ef7dfc394d4e0bbebc913f6f4dcd0e26daa
1 Input
1 Output
-
e16f59108b9b0a575997cdb075732ef7dfc394d4e0bbebc913f6f4dcd0e26daa:0
- value
- 82707
- script pubkey
- OP_0 OP_PUSHBYTES_20 3517a5059b756362054d73066dba15bdbcb5ab61
- address
- bc1qx5t62pvmw43kyp2dwvrxmws4hk7tt2mpaj69yf